BROWN RUDNICK LLP 401K PROFIT SHARING PLAN A Contribution & Match Policy
BROWN RUDNICK LLP 401K PROFIT SHARING PLAN A Contribution, Match and Other Plan Policies
- Participants may contribute up to 75% of their eligible compensation (100% of bonus) on a pre-tax or after-tax Roth basis, subject to Internal Revenue Code (IRC) limitations.
- Participants who are at least age 50 may make an additional catch-up contribution subject to IRC limitations.
- The Firm makes a matching contribution for all eligible participants other than those specifically excluded in the plan document of 50% of the first 2% of participant contributions, for a maximum of 1% of compensation.
- In addition, the Firm may make a non-safe harbor non-elective contribution.
- For 2024, the Firm made a non-safe harbor non-elective contribution of 5% of annual compensation for most eligible non-partner participants (staff) other than those specifically excluded in the plan document.
- Participants are fully vested in that portion of their account which relates to their contributions, Firm contributions, and the income earned thereon.
2025 IRS 401(k) Contribution Limits
The IRS sets annual limits on how much you and your employer can contribute to a 401(k) plan. Knowing these limits helps you maximize tax-advantaged savings. Here are the current limits:
| 2024 | 2025 | |
|---|---|---|
| Employee elective deferrals (pretax + Roth) | $23,000 | $23,500 |
| Employee + employer contributions combined | $69,000 | $70,000 |
| Catch-up contributions (age 50+) | $7,500 | $7,500 |
| Enhanced catch-up (ages 60–63, SECURE 2.0) | N/A | $11,250 |
